Modelling the Sounds of Standard Jamaican English in a Grade 2 Classroom

In Jamaica, from grade 1 up, patterns of the Standard Jamaican English (SJE) sound system are taught in classes with a view to helping children become conscious of the different shapes of sounds. The aim of this article is to examine one of those patterns: the pronunciation of (-t, -d) consonants in word-final consonant clusters in words such as must, went, accident, cold, left. Twenty-four children-seven years of age and one teacher were studied.
